Headword: 
*zw/nh 
Adler number: zeta,140
Translated headword: belt, girdle
Vetting Status: high
Translation: Figuratively [meaning] strength. Since one who is girded is better equipped for action.
 Greek Original:*zw/nh: tropikw=s h( du/namis. e)peidh\ o( e)zwsme/nos eu)stale/stero/s e)sti pro\s th\n pra=cin. 
Notes: 
For this headword see also 
zeta 139 and 
zeta 141. The present entry follows Theodoret (PG 80.1352b), commenting on 
Psalm 64.8 
LXX. 
The 
zone (Latin 
cingulum) was a badge of military and civil service; according to Lampe s.v., Gregory of Nazianzus uses 
zone symbolically for temperance and manliness.
